Frequently Asked Questions about Delawanna

How much are Studio apartments in Delawanna?

There are currently 100 Studio Apartments in Delawanna with rent ranges from $1,500 to $2,350 with an average price of $2,050.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Delawanna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Delawanna ranges from $1,330 to $3,700 with an average monthly rent of $2,383.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Delawanna c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Delawanna range from $1,995 to $9,289.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,397.

How expensive are Delawanna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 34 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Delawanna on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,300 to $4,700 - averaging $3,062 for the location.
